I would like to use Atlassian Access and authenticate users via SAML and log them in via a Keycloak server. For many other services (and also when using Confluence and JIRA server versions) this works fine, but for Atlassian Access I am required to verify our domain, which I currently cannot do. Are there any alternatives?

Hey @Matthias Böhmer - in order for you to enforce SSO using Atlassian Access, you will need to first verify a domain and manage the users on that domain. You will then be able to set an authentication policy for those managed users.
